Definition of Cosmetology<\/strong><\/h3>\n

\"ParkCosmetology is an occupation that is all about making the human anatomy look more beautiful with the use of cosmetics. So naturally it makes sense that numerous cosmetology schools are regarded as beauty schools. Many of us think of makeup when we hear the word cosmetics, but basically a cosmetic may be anything that enhances the appearance of a person’s skin, hair or nails. In order to work as a cosmetologist, the majority of states require that you take some type of specialized training and then become licensed. Once you are licensed, the work environments include not only Park Ridge IL beauty salons and barber shops, but also such places as spas, hotels and resorts. Many cosmetologists, once they have acquired experience and a clientele, establish their own shops or salons. Others will begin seeing customers either in their own residences or will go to the client’s residence, or both.
